The Mechanics of Becoming A Morgue Insider: 5 To 7 Years To Uncover The Truth

So, what exactly does it take to become a morgue insider? Typically, this journey involves a minimum of five to seven years of dedication and hard work. The path to becoming a full-fledged morgue insider requires mastering various skills and disciplines, including:

  • Obtaining a degree in mortuary science or a related field
  • Completing an apprenticeship or gaining hands-on experience at a mortuary or funeral home
  • Acquiring relevant certifications and licenses to practice in this field
  • Developing expertise in areas such as embalming, cremation, and funeral planning
  • Staying up-to-date with industry developments, regulations, and best practices

Career Opportunities in Mortuary Science

As a morgue insider, you'll have access to a wide range of career opportunities. Some of the most rewarding roles include:

  • Mortician or funeral director
  • Embalmer or restorer
  • Crematory operator or funeral service coordinator
  • Deathcare consultant or bereavement counselor

Addressing Common Curiosities and Misconceptions

One of the most intriguing aspects of becoming a morgue insider is debunking myths and misconceptions surrounding mortuary science. Many people believe that working in a morgue is a morbid or unsettling experience, but the truth is quite different.

Morgue professionals are dedicated individuals who provide essential services to families during their most vulnerable times. They work tirelessly to ensure that the deceased are treated with dignity and respect, often going above and beyond to accommodate the family's wishes.
